For her Capstone project, Grade 12 student Kimran Boparai wanted to do something meaningful to raise awareness of organ donation and to help individuals who are waiting for organ transplants. Until last year, Kimran’s family was waiting and hoping for a kidney transplant for her younger brother.
“My 9-year-old brother spent the first eight years of his life in and out of the BC Children’s Hospital having kidney dialysis and multiple surgeries,” said Kimran…. Read more »

More than 180 students and educators, including 45 students from the Boys and Girls Clubs at Sands Secondary and North Delta Secondary, visited Rogers Arena, the home of the Vancouver Canucks, on Wednesday, February 28 to hear stories of resiliency from Canucks players and executives.
The event was part of Lessons in the Locker Room,… Read more »
